当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象存储 文件系统,深入探讨对象存储与文件系统的区别与融合,构建高效数据管理解决方案

对象存储 文件系统,深入探讨对象存储与文件系统的区别与融合,构建高效数据管理解决方案

本文深入剖析对象存储与文件系统的异同,探讨二者融合趋势,旨在构建高效数据管理解决方案,助力企业实现数据存储的智能化与优化。...

本文深入剖析对象存储与文件系统的异同,探讨二者融合趋势,旨在构建高效数据管理解决方案,助力企业实现数据存储的智能化与优化。

随着大数据时代的到来,数据量呈爆炸式增长,传统的文件系统在处理海量数据时逐渐显露出局限性,为了应对这一挑战,对象存储应运而生,它以分布式、高扩展性、低成本等优势逐渐成为数据存储的主流方式,对象存储与传统文件系统在数据组织、访问方式等方面存在较大差异,这给用户带来了一定的困扰,本文将深入探讨对象存储与文件系统的区别与融合,以期为构建高效数据管理解决方案提供参考。

对象存储与文件系统的区别

1、数据组织方式

对象存储 文件系统,深入探讨对象存储与文件系统的区别与融合,构建高效数据管理解决方案

对象存储将数据以对象的形式存储,每个对象包含数据本身、元数据以及唯一标识符,对象存储的数据组织方式具有以下特点:

(1)无固定目录结构:对象存储不依赖于文件系统的目录结构,数据可以按需存储,方便进行横向扩展。

(2)高并发访问:对象存储支持高并发访问,适用于大规模数据访问场景。

(3)数据容错:对象存储通过分布式存储技术实现数据冗余,提高数据可靠性。

文件系统以目录和文件为基本单位,具有以下特点:

(1)树状目录结构:文件系统具有明确的目录结构,便于管理和查找数据。

(2)低并发访问:文件系统在并发访问方面存在瓶颈,不适合大规模数据访问场景。

(3)数据容错:文件系统主要通过备份和恢复机制实现数据容错。

2、访问方式

对象存储 文件系统,深入探讨对象存储与文件系统的区别与融合,构建高效数据管理解决方案

对象存储采用RESTful API进行访问,用户可以通过HTTP请求实现数据的上传、下载、删除等操作,对象存储的访问方式具有以下特点:

(1)简单易用:RESTful API易于理解和实现,方便用户进行编程。

(2)跨平台:RESTful API支持多种编程语言和平台,具有良好的兼容性。

(3)安全性:对象存储支持HTTPS协议,确保数据传输的安全性。

文件系统采用文件路径进行访问,用户通过文件路径找到所需数据,文件系统的访问方式具有以下特点:

(1)熟悉易懂:文件路径易于理解和记忆,用户操作习惯良好。

(2)局限性:文件路径受限于文件系统的目录结构,不利于数据横向扩展。

(3)安全性:文件系统访问安全性相对较低,易受恶意攻击。

对象存储与文件系统的融合

针对对象存储与文件系统在数据组织、访问方式等方面的差异,可以通过以下方式实现融合:

对象存储 文件系统,深入探讨对象存储与文件系统的区别与融合,构建高效数据管理解决方案

1、使用统一的命名空间

将对象存储与文件系统结合,可以使用统一的命名空间对数据进行组织,可以将文件系统中的目录映射为对象存储中的桶(Bucket),将文件映射为对象(Object),这样,用户可以通过文件路径访问对象存储中的数据,实现文件系统与对象存储的融合。

2、集成文件系统访问接口

在对象存储中集成文件系统访问接口,例如S3 API,允许用户使用文件系统的方式进行数据访问,这样,用户可以利用现有的文件系统工具和技能,轻松实现数据迁移和访问。

3、数据分层存储

根据数据访问频率和重要性,将数据分层存储,高频访问数据存储在对象存储中,低频访问数据存储在文件系统中,通过数据分层存储,可以提高数据访问效率,降低存储成本。

对象存储与文件系统在数据组织、访问方式等方面存在差异,但通过融合技术可以实现优势互补,本文从数据组织、访问方式等方面分析了对象存储与文件系统的区别,并提出了融合方案,在实际应用中,可以根据具体需求选择合适的技术方案,构建高效数据管理解决方案。

黑狐家游戏

发表评论

最新文章